The blend is Cabernet Sauvignon, Syrah, Merlot and Malbec. Cab Sauv brings rich black currants, as well as thick tannins. Merlot adds softer notes of cherries and violets. The Malbec increases the tannins, along with notes of grilled meat bone that Syrah, with its peppery, beef-jerky meatiness, enhances. The result is a young, vigorous wine, dry and balanced in acidity. It may or may not age, but there's no reason not to decant it now and enjoy with grilled beefsteak.
